Transaction 6dd9976fc2b77c9df2212e13e392fb128223a032703b7339e3b0e3d640842d4e

block
c1273544bbf90b7b8b7c6c78588420f7751fa9734d57316590817a71edded010

26 Inputs

3 Outputs